Deficiency record · 11

09 - Working and Living Conditions › 091 - Living Conditions › Electrical devices
Issued 22 July 2026 Resolved
Each distribution panel or switchboard on a towing vessel must be: totally enclosed and of dead-front type. Marine Inspector observed that several switchboards were missing switch covers. Take appropriate action to cover all exposed parts on the switchboards and provide proof to the OCMI.
Action required: 16 - Rectify deficiencies w/in 14 days
Due 5 August 2026
Resolved 5 August 2026
Resolution: operator provided photo proof of attaching switch covers to open switches.
02 - Structural Conditions › N/A - No Subsystem › Ballast, fuel and other tanks
Issued 28 July 2023 Resolved
Machinery systems must be designed and maintained to provide for safe operation of the towing vessel and safety of the person on board. Vessel rep reported fuel discharge from starboard bow fuel tank. Marine Inspector shall observe fuel tank upon being emptied. Provide repair plan and make repairs to the satisfaction of the attending Marine Inspector.
Condition: Improper/Lack of Maintenance
Action required: 60 - Rectify deficiencies prior to movement
Due 30 August 2023
Resolved 3 August 2023
Resolution: Vessel replaced wasted pipe and pressure tested system in presence in of Marine Inspector. All Sat.
13 - Propulsion and Auxiliary Machinery › N/A - No Subsystem › Other (machinery)
Issued 8 July 2022 Resolved
To stop the flow of fuel in the event of a fire or break in the fuel line a remote fuel shut off must be...operable from a safe place outside the space where the valve is installed. Vessel has 4 fuel shut off pulls. upon testing 2 of the 4 wires broke before the valve was able to close completely. Repair and reconfigure all shut offs to close completely from outside the space.
Condition: Improper/Lack of Maintenance
Action required: 16 - Rectify deficiencies w/in 14 days
Due 22 July 2022
Resolved 27 July 2022
Resolution: Recieved Video of all 4 shut offs operating properly after modifications.
